Usefulness of CI-581 [2- (O-Chlorophenyl) -2-Methyl Aminocyclohexanone Hydrochloride] as a Short Acting Anesthetic Drug for Cynomolgus Monkey (Macaca irus)

Abstract
Ten cynomolgus monkeys of 3-5 years of age weighing from 2.30 to 3.33 kg were administered intramuscularly with CI-581. For 5 consecutive days, the animals were injected with the drug at dose level of 2.5 mg per kg of body weight on the 1st day, 5 mg/kg on the 2 nd day, 10 mg/kg on the 3 rd day, 20 mg/kg on the 4 th day and 40 mg/kg on the last day.
General conditions of the animals were observed, and both the induction and duration times of narcosis were measured. Rectal temperature was taken just before and 30-40 min. after the administration.
In all of the monkeys, the process of induction and duration of narcotic effect was remarkably smooth. The monkeys recovered from the narcosis safely and smoothly.
Table 1. summarized the induction time, the duration time and the decrease of rectal temperature. As shown in the table, the larger the dose used, the shorter the induction time and the longer the duration time.
The present results indicate that CI-581 is a practically useful anesthetic drug for cynomolgus monkey when administered intramuscularly at the dose level of 10-20 mg/kg.
